We live and recover

For all of you who care for us helped or help us here’s a little „update“ on the development of the injuries of everyone involved with the accident of Bombenalarm. On the 22nd of September the right back tire of our van blew on the way to our show in Berlin and the van tumbled 3 times. About three weeks later 5 of the 6 that were inside the van left the hospital and are back home again. The wounds and bones are healing but slowly….
Marc’s foot is broken and so are some parts of his spine. He has crutches and a corset and will be really limited for the next months. Norman has some broken ribs. It’ll also take a while for him till everything is alright again. Stachel has several broken ribs and a broken shoulder. He had to stay for a quite long time in intensive care in hospital which took away a lot of strength. But he’s also doing much better and he is back home in Bremen now. Sarah (our friend from Muelheim) has some broken ribs and a broken shoulder as well. Due to the incompetence of the doctors in Braunschweig (the first hospital she went to) she moved to a different hospital in Essen to get an operation there. Of course this operation should have been made much earlier, which means that things are more complicated for here now. Fabian will be ok in a couple of weeks when his arm is totally healed again. Christoph just had some minor injuries which are almost fully healed already.
It looks like everyone had a health insurance. So we don’t expect high costs concerning this. It’s difficult to say how much money we will need for the van and equipment and stuff right now as we don’t know yet how much the assurance will pay. I guess the worst case would be something like 10.000 €. But we hope and also expect that the assurance will pay something.
